Production Planning Team Leader
Job Description
At Emerson, we don’t just support essential industries, we help them thrive. From water and mining to oil and gas, our cutting-edge technologies and passionate people solve real-world challenges every day. We’re seeking a Production Planning Team Leader to lead and coordinate our planning team in driving efficient scheduling, resource optimization, and timely product delivery to Emerson customers. This role plays a critical part in aligning planning activities with business goals, customer expectations, and operational capabilities.
In this role, you will:
Lead and supervise the planning team in day-to-day operations, ensuring alignment with business goals.
Develop and maintain production, project, bundle, and material plans to meet delivery targets.
Monitor and report on team performance, critical metrics, and planning accuracy.
Ensure realistic and achievable schedules based on capacity, resource availability, and sales forecasts.
Identify and lead process improvements to enhance planning efficiency and accuracy.
Act as the point person for addressing customer and partner concerns related to planning issues and ensure timely resolution.
Collaborate with cross-functional teams to align forecasts, production plans, and inventory strategies.
Manage customer DIFOT (Delivery In Full On Time) performance.
Oversee valve strip, access, and quote processes for customer orders.
Train and mentor team members to foster continuous development and high performance.
Conduct daily reviews of new orders and delivery dates with the team.
Communicate proactively with Sales and customers regarding delivery date changes and product availability.
Monitor and expedite planned backlog lists for upcoming weeks.
Review and action MRP requirements in coordination with the Site Buyer and Inventory Controller.
Support quotation and planning of customer orders.

For this role, you will need:
- Tertiary qualifications in a relevant field.
- Operational experience, ideally within engineering, construction, or a similar industry.
- Proven experience in production planning.
- Strong knowledge of Emerson products and services.
- Proficiency in planning software (e.g., SAP, Oracle, Excel).
- Demonstrated leadership and team development experience.
